Small yachts are typically shorter than 33 feet (10 m) length overall. [36] Trailer sailers that are readily towed by a car are generally shorter than 25 feet (7.6 m) length overall and weigh less than 5,000 pounds (2,300 kg). [34] Near-shore yachts typically range in size from 33–45 feet (10–14 m) length overall. [5]

Beam – A measure of the width of the ship. There are two types: Beam, Overall (BOA), commonly referred to simply as Beam – The overall width of the ship measured at the widest point of the nominal waterline.
